Accessing the Exclusive NAIA Terminal 3 Lounges
Now, you might be wondering, "How do I actually get into these magical places?" That's a great question, and thankfully, there are several ways to gain access to the fantastic lounges at Ninoy Aquino International Airport Lounge Terminal 3. One of the most common routes is through airline alliances and premium cabin tickets. If you're flying in business or first class with a particular airline or one of its partners, lounge access is often included as part of your ticket. Similarly, frequent flyer status within certain airline alliances (like Star Alliance, Oneworld, or SkyTeam) can grant you access, even if you're flying in economy. It’s always worth checking your elite status benefits! Another popular and increasingly accessible option is through credit card memberships. Many premium travel credit cards offer complimentary lounge access as a perk. Cards like the American Express Platinum, various Priority Pass memberships, or even some local bank credit cards might come with lounge access programs. These programs often give you a set number of free visits per year or unlimited access to a wide network of lounges worldwide, including those at NAIA. Lounge membership programs are also a thing! Companies like Priority Pass, LoungeKey, and DragonPass offer annual memberships that allow you access to their network of partner lounges. You can often choose from different tiers of membership depending on how often you expect to use the lounges. This can be a cost-effective solution if you travel frequently but don't always fly premium cabins or have elite status. For those who just want a one-time indulgence or are traveling infrequently, purchasing a day pass is often an option. Some lounges allow you to buy access directly at the reception desk or online in advance. While this is usually the most expensive option per visit, it's a great way to try out the lounge experience without a long-term commitment. Keep in mind that availability for day passes can vary, especially during peak travel seasons. Finally, some specific airlines might operate their own standalone lounges in Terminal 3, and access is typically restricted to their own passengers or those flying with their partner airlines. Popular Lounge Options at NAIA Terminal 3
Alright, let's talk specifics! While the lounge landscape can change, here are some of the types of lounges and common providers you might encounter at Ninoy Aquino International Airport Lounge Terminal 3. Keep in mind that specific lounge names and availability can vary, so it's always best to confirm with your airline or a lounge access provider before your trip. One of the most widely recognized names in airport lounges is Priority Pass. If you have a Priority Pass membership (often obtained through a credit card or direct subscription), you'll likely have access to lounges like the Marhaba Lounge. The Marhaba Lounge is a popular choice, known for its comfortable seating, decent food and beverage selection, and generally good amenities. It’s often praised for providing a calm environment to escape the terminal’s hustle. Another common provider you might see affiliated with various credit cards and programs is LoungeKey. The specific lounges available through LoungeKey can differ, but they aim to offer similar comforts – a quiet space, refreshments, and Wi-Fi. Some airlines also operate their own dedicated lounges. For instance, Philippine Airlines has its Mabuhay Lounges. Access to these is typically restricted to passengers flying in premium classes on Philippine Airlines or those with top-tier elite status within the PAL loyalty program. These lounges often feature a more distinct local flavor in their offerings and design. Other airline-specific lounges might exist depending on the carriers operating out of Terminal 3, so if you're flying a major international carrier, check if they have their own dedicated space. For travelers flying with specific alliances, check which lounges are designated for your alliance members. Sometimes, these are shared spaces managed by third parties but designated for specific alliance flyers. It's also worth noting that airport authorities sometimes operate general pay-per-use lounges that are not tied to specific airlines or credit cards, offering a straightforward option for anyone willing to pay for access. Maximizing Your Lounge Experience
So, you've managed to snag access to one of the awesome lounges at Ninoy Aquino International Airport Lounge Terminal 3. High five! But how do you make the most out of this little slice of airport paradise? It’s more than just finding a comfy seat, guys. First off, plan your arrival time wisely. Don't rush to the lounge the second you get to the airport, but also don't cut it so close that you can't actually enjoy the amenities. Aim to get to the lounge about 1.5 to 2 hours before your flight departure time. This gives you ample time to settle in, grab some food and drinks, catch up on emails, or just relax without feeling hurried. Explore all the offerings. Lounges aren't just about the snacks! Check out the seating options – some areas might be quieter for working, while others are more relaxed for lounging. See if there are shower facilities available; a quick refresh can make a huge difference, especially on long journeys. Take advantage of the complimentary Wi-Fi and charging ports to power up your devices and stay connected. If you have work to do, utilize the business centers if available. Be mindful of the food and drinks. Sample the local delicacies if they're offered! It's a great way to experience a bit of Filipino flavor before you fly. Pace yourself with the alcoholic beverages, though – you don't want to be that person on the plane! Remember, the goal is to feel refreshed, not groggy. Stay informed about your flight. While lounges offer a sanctuary, it's still your responsibility to keep track of your flight's status. Most lounges have screens displaying flight information, but it's always a good idea to periodically check the departure boards or your airline's app. Don't rely solely on lounge announcements, as they might not always be timely or audible. Respect the space and other guests. Lounges are shared spaces. Keep your voice down, especially if others are working or resting. Tidy up after yourself, and be considerate when taking food or drinks. Remember, a little courtesy goes a long way in ensuring a pleasant environment for everyone. Know the rules. Some lounges have time limits, dress codes (though usually relaxed), or guest policies. Familiarize yourself with these beforehand to avoid any awkward situations.
